F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E: July 10, 2012 CONTACT: Apryl Marie Fogel AprylMarie.Fogel@mail.house.gov MEDIA ADVISORY: Congressman Gosar’s Staff to Host Office Hours in Payson on July 19th U.S. Congressman Paul A. Gosar, DDS (R-AZ) announced that his office will be holding office hours in Payson on Thursday, July 19th from 12:00 p.m. to 3:00 p.m. The event is open to the public. Staff will answer questions and provide help with the Veterans Administration and veterans’ benefits, social security, issues with federal agencies, including the Environmental Protection Agency, Department of Agriculture, Forest Service, or issues with the Department of Health and Human Services, Bureau of Indian Affairs, and other federal agencies. PAYSON OFFICE HOURS Thursday, July 19, 2012 12:00 p.m. – 3:00 p.m. Supervisor Tommie Martin's Office 610 E Hwy 260 Payson, AZ Since being sworn in as the Representative of Arizona’s First Congressional District, Congressman Gosar has participated in over 25 town halls across the district. In addition, he has conducted eight tele-town halls while in Washington, D.C. His staff has hosted over a dozen district open office hours.
